On Monday, the price for a barrel of West Texas Intermediate crude oil closed at <a href=\"https:\/\/www.zerohedge.com\/markets\/here-full-explanation-behind-oils-unprecedented-negative-price\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><em><strong>negative<\/strong><\/em> $37.56<\/a>. In other words, oil producers and speculators had to pay their customers to take the oil off their hands! No, really.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#008000;\"><strong>Credit:<\/strong><\/span> Of course, aside from being catastrophic for the oil industry, this is <a href=\"https:\/\/www.jsmineset.com\/2020\/04\/21\/negative-oil\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">another nail in the petrodollar&#8217;s coffin<\/a>. Yes, <em><strong>that<\/strong><\/em> Pope.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#ff0000;\"><strong>Debit:<\/strong><\/span> Despite <a href=\"https:\/\/chapwoodindex.com\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">inflation running at roughly 10%<\/a> today, many people are wondering when the inflation fireworks will really start. Well &#8230; in the US, <a href=\"https:\/\/goldsilver.com\/blog\/heres-how-high-inflation-could-soar-and-how-quickly-it-could-get-there\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">inflation has spiked quickly<\/a> before. For example: In 1915, it took just two years to skyrocket from 1% to 17%; between 1945 and 1947 inflation soared from 2% to 14%; and in 1972 inflation was 3.2% &#8212; but it quickly climbed to 11% by 1974. Here are the latest stats concerning the effect of the pandemic on the American restaurant industry:<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>500,000<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Number of independent restaurants in the country.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>8,000,000<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Restaurant industry jobs that have been lost nationwide.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>67<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Percentage of all US restaurant jobs that have been lost due to the coronavirus shut down.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>56<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Percentage of independent restaurants that have at least $50,000 in new debt as a result of the pandemic.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>70<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Percentage of sales lost by American breweries.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>73<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Percentage of sales lost during the first 10 days in April by the coffee and snack segment.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>$30,000,000,000<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Revenue lost by the American restaurant industry in March.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>$80,000,000,000<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Projected lost US restaurant sales by the end of April.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#0000ff;\"><span style=\"font-size: x-large;\"><strong>$240,000,000,000<\/strong><\/span><\/span> Projected lost US restaurant industry sales by the end of 2020.<\/p>\n<p><em>Source: <a href=\"https:\/\/preview.houstonchronicle.com\/dining\/by-the-numbers-how-the-coronavirus-pandemic-has-15224103\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">The Houston Chronicle<\/a><\/em><\/p>\n<p><strong>Useless News: Restaurant Recommendation<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Two elderly gentlemen were talking, and one said, &#8220;Last night my wife and I went out to a new restaurant and it was really great; I recommend it highly.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>The other man said, &#8220;What is the name of the restaurant?&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>The first man thought a while and finally said, &#8220;What&#8217;s the name of that flower you give to someone you love?
